The Enigmatic World Of Carstensen
Kling & Bang gallery
Runs until June 26
Free
The new collection by Danish artist Claus Carstensen has arrived to Reykjavik. His
mix of techniques creates an impressive body of work that combines paintings
and collages that surely won’t disappoint visitors. The ‘Silent Room, Silver Room’
exhibition shows some of these surreal and enigmatic works that have become a
trademark of Cartensen’s style, mesmerising the observer. This is an exhibit that
shouldn’t be missed, so hurry to Kling & Bang before June 26. JH

High Five For Hyphae (Pronounced Hi-Fa)
Bakkus, Tryggvagata 22
June 4, 21:30
Free
A new way of “going” to shows may be upon us. At the Korzo theatre in The Hague
(Netherlands) they will be live-streaming a concert broadcast from Reykjavík’s
very own Bakkus. The show can also be seen from your very own computer via
http://hyphae.nl. This is the very first Hyphae show, and they hope to continue this
venture in the future by broadcasting shows live not only from proper venues, but
also from live parties, or even the musicians’ own homes. The artists performing at
Bakkus will also be able to see the audience at The Hague, while the audience is
viewing them. A cool, new way of seeing concerts worth being a part of. And you
get to view it live. Live live. Like…in person. Line up: Skurken, Tonk, Beatmakin
Troopa, Orang Volta, Plat, Steve Sampling, Murya, and Futuregrapher. SAT
